An emperor penguin walked 16.8 km across the ice in 6 hours. What was the penguin's average speed?

History
1 answer:
vivado [14]3 years ago
7 0
The answer is 2.8 because you / 16.8/6=2.8

8. What was the purpose of the Civil Rights Act?
padilas [110]

Answer:

The Civil Rights Act of 1964, which ended segregation in public places and banned employment discrimination on the basis of race, color, religion, sex or national origin, is considered one of the crowning legislative achievements of the civil rights movement
